Blaublitz Akita enters the J2 League fixture as the marginal favorite due to its mid-table position at 10th compared to Ventforet Kofu's 20th-place standing. Recent form tempers expectations, as Akita suffered a heavy 0-4 home defeat to Kataller Toyama on August 15 before a 1-1 draw with Jubilo Iwata, while Kofu managed a 1-1 draw against Tegevajaro Miyazaki but fell 0-2 to Sagan Tosu. Home advantage at Soyu Stadium and a slightly stronger overall record support the 41% implied probability for an Akita win, yet both sides' inconsistent results and defensive vulnerabilities keep draw odds competitive near 31.5%. Kofu's lower-table struggles contribute to the 26% away-win pricing, though historical head-to-head data shows mixed outcomes.
